That’s a feature when you have an iPhone with 2 active cellular plans (Dual Sim is available on iPhone XR, XS, 11, 12, 13, 14 and SE 3.)

The way iPhone handles Dual Sim does not allow Data to be active on both plans at the same time (that means the iPhone uses can receive and send calls on both sims all the time but uses the data plan of only one, even if the second one has better reception).

The feature OP asks about, allows iPhone to switch to the second data line if the first one fails due to bad coverage.
